Over the past few weeks, I’ve been enjoying Mordhau and Battlefront 2 without any problems. However, this week I've encountered some issues. During large-scale matches, my frame rates have decreased to between 10 and 20. This wasn't a previous concern, and I'm puzzled as to the cause.

System Specifications:
Processor: Intel Core i7-7700 CPU @ 3.60GHz
RAM: 16 GB
Video Card: N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1060 3GB
Operating System: Windows 10 Version 10.0.18362
